Posted on Friday, March 1, 2013
a date with Judy We've been hoping to work with the wonderful Judy Kuhn since we started PS Classics, but the right opportunity never came along. Last year, she came to us after some hugely successful dates at Feinstein’s, to see if we wanted to help her preserve the evening on disc. We wanted to – but all our monies at that point were tied up with Follies and Porgy. So Judy, God bless her, started a Kickstarter campaign, and her fans, God bless them, really came through. And by the time Judy had almost reached her goal and was ready to go into the studio, we were able to jump back on board and help her bring the album to fruition. Posted on Friday, February 22, 2013
...but she's only a dream
We recently posted a new About Us column, hinting at some upcoming projects. The first of these, which we’re thrilled to announce, is LAURA OSNES: IF I TELL YOU (SONGS OF MAURY YESTON).. Laura performed her evening of Yeston at 54 Below in November; we were overwhelmed, as was Maury, and once she opens in Rodgers and Hammerstein’s Cinderella, we’ll be taking her and her band into the studio to preserve the evening on disc. (Maury has even reached into his trunk this past month to allow her to premiere a few Yeston gems that weren’t in the concert; it is, after all, the first solo disc of Yeston songs, done with Maury’s cooperation, input and blessing.)
